Modern, secure MCP server for accessing ZIM format knowledge bases offline. Enables AI models to search and navigate Wikipedia, educational content, and other compressed knowledge archives with smart retrieval, caching, and comprehensive API.
Read-only access to the AI Loop Library catalog: 63+ bounded, verifiable agent work loops. pickloopforgoal recommends a loop for a stated goal and renderrunprotocol emits an executable markdown protocol with verification, stop conditions, budgets, and approval gates. Single-file, stdlib-only stdio server.

Openzim Mcp Tools (6)
Supports ZIM archives from Kiwix Library
Advanced 8-tool schema plus Simple natural-language query mode
Archive-type presets for optimized retrieval per source
Inbound link discovery and link graph extraction
Streamable HTTP and stdio transport modes
Caching and pagination for responsive queries
